/*
* Code generated by Speakeasy (https://speakeasy.com). DO NOT EDIT.
*/
import * as z from "zod";
/**
* Incidents_ChannelEntity model
*/
export type IncidentsChannelEntity = {
id?: string | null | undefined;
name?: string | null | undefined;
source?: string | null | undefined;
source_name?: string | null | undefined;
source_id?: string | null | undefined;
url?: string | null | undefined;
icon_url?: string | null | undefined;
status?: string | null | undefined;
};
export const IncidentsChannelEntity$zodSchema: z.ZodType<
IncidentsChannelEntity
> = z.object({
icon_url: z.string().nullable().optional(),
id: z.string().nullable().optional(),
name: z.string().nullable().optional(),
source: z.string().nullable().optional(),
source_id: z.string().nullable().optional(),
source_name: z.string().nullable().optional(),
status: z.string().nullable().optional(),
url: z.string().nullable().optional(),
}).describe("Incidents_ChannelEntity model");